Johnson & Johnson agreed to pay about $5.5 billion to resolve remaining lawsuits alleging that long-term use of talc-based baby powder caused ovarian cancer — even after winning most major trials that reached juries. The settlement, reached after almost 12 years of litigation, underlines how scientific uncertainty, courtroom dynamics and corporate risk management can intersect with profound financial consequences.
Scientific uncertainty and the limits of proof
For decades researchers have evaluated whether talc exposure can cause ovarian cancer. Studies have produced conflicting results: some suggest a possible link, while others find no clear causal relationship. That scientific ambiguity became central to courtroom battles, as expert witnesses on both sides were unable to provide definitive statements that talc directly caused cancer.
"If science itself remains uncertain, how can plaintiffs prove their claims with certainty?"
That question, raised during court proceedings, crystallises a central problem: legal standards of proof and scientific standards of evidence do not always align. Courts must weigh competing expert testimony, epidemiological studies and individual plaintiffs’ accounts, while science continues to probe mechanisms and population-level associations.
Why a company that was winning trials would settle
On its face, it seems paradoxical that a company prevailing in many trials would opt for a multibillion-dollar settlement. But legal strategy and business calculus often differ from courtroom outcomes. Several practical considerations can drive such a decision:
- Scale of exposure: Thousands of claims can accumulate over many years; the sheer volume raises the prospect of unpredictable future verdicts.
- Cost and uncertainty: Even with trial victories, continued litigation risks producing a single large adverse judgment that could exceed projected settlement costs.
- Reputational and market risk: Ongoing headlines and adverse publicity can harm brand value and sales beyond legal liabilities.
In this case, the company’s decision to settle appears to reflect a determination that resolving the remaining claims through an agreed payment was preferable to the long-term unpredictability of litigation, even where many individual trials ended favourably for the defendant.
Implications for public health communications and consumer trust
The talc lawsuits exposed how public fear can outpace scientific consensus. For many consumers, a staple like baby powder has long personal and cultural associations, and allegations linking it to cancer create strong emotional reactions. The coverage and courtroom drama amplified those fears, regardless of unresolved scientific questions.
That divergence between perception and evidence presents a challenge for scientists and public-health authorities: communicate uncertainty without appearing equivocal, and convey nuanced risk assessments in ways that are understandable and actionable for the public. When legal outcomes and settlements become visible proxies for scientific truth, public understanding can be distorted.
What remains to be resolved
Even after this settlement, the underlying scientific debate is unresolved. Epidemiologists and toxicologists will continue to investigate potential mechanisms, exposure pathways and population-level associations. Meanwhile, the legal landscape may still influence research priorities and regulatory attention.

The settlement does not establish a scientific finding. It resolves legal claims for business reasons, not necessarily because of conclusive evidence of causation. For policymakers, regulators and scientists, the episode is a reminder that high-profile litigation can shape public perception and corporate behaviour in ways that extend beyond the laboratory.
